According to a research report “Vector Control Market by Technology (Chemical, Physical & Mechanical, Biological), Control Method (Comprehensive, Integrated Vector Management, Targeted), Vector Type, End-Use Sector, Mode of Application and Region – Global Forecast to 2029” published by MarketsandMarkets, the global vector control market is estimated at USD 21.72 billion in 2024 and is projected to reach USD 29.80 billion by 2029, growing at a CAGR of 6.5% during 2024–2029. This report provides a comprehensive vector control market analysis covering key technologies, control methods, and end-use sectors.
The market is fueled primarily by the prevalence of vector-borne diseases such as malaria, dengue, and Zika, alongside growing public health awareness. Governments and health agencies are increasingly investing in preventive measures to curb disease vectors, integrating traditional control methods with advanced technologies like AI-driven surveillance and biological solutions. Regulatory shifts toward eco-friendly practices are also driving demand for novel, sustainable vector control solutions. Urbanization and rising population densities further emphasize the need for effective vector management. Biological Vector Control Gaining Momentum
Among technologies, the biological segment is witnessing rapid growth due to increased demand for sustainable and environmentally safe pest management methods. With concerns over the environmental impact of chemical pesticides, biological approaches target pests while minimizing harm to non-target species and ecosystems. For instance, Anticimex (Sweden) offers Bti (Bacillus thuringiensis israelensis) treatment, a bacterium that selectively kills mosquito larvae without affecting humans, pets, or other wildlife.

Europe Holds Significant Market Share
Europe represents a major share of the vector control market, thanks to strict public health regulations and high awareness of vector-borne diseases. The region invests heavily in effective control measures and fosters innovation in technologies like biological control and integrated pest management. Agencies such as the European Centre for Disease Control (ECDC) actively monitor diseases like West Nile fever and tick-borne encephalitis, providing risk assessments and outbreak information across the EU and its territories.
